As will become apparent with viewing, the nine-teen images shown here are sequential, each image incorporated into the next.  Though the images are presented in a linear fashion, and thus could be said to form a narrative (albeit abstract) the overall affect conjures up a spiral; no matter how far the sequence progresses the original image of sand and stone always resides, unseen to the eye, within the photograph.  

And thus a conundrum is presented: will the work continue ad-infinitum or somehow resolve itself (as, for instance, in Duane Michals' Things are queer.), and if so, how?

The sequence currently runs to over one hundred images on Mark-Steffen's own site (a link to which is provided below), of which 1-19 are shown below, and no conclusion seems near!
